检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
机构地区:[1]海军航空工程学院控制工程系,山东烟台264001
出 处:《小型微型计算机系统》2010年第8期1625-1628,共4页Journal of Chinese Computer Systems
基 金:国家自然科学基金项目(60705030)资助
摘 要:对于交互式软件而言,功能的实现是通过复杂的人机交互完成的,目前的功能测试用例生成方法常常只考虑软件的界面信息,而不考虑软件的具体需求和逻辑实现流程,这就导致产生的测试用例随意性较大,测试过程难以有序进行,为此,本文将软件功能的逻辑实现流程和界面信息结合在一起考虑,提出一种基于数据流图的测试用例生成方法,以业务处理中数据的流向来描述业务流程,生成测试用例.该方法能够生成有效的测试用例,更全面地测试交互式软件功能,并便于定位错误.For interactive software,function is completed with complicated human-machine interactions.Current test case generation methods of function testing usually consider software interface,while ignoring software requirement and logic completion process.With these testing methods,test cases are generated ignorantly,and testing process may be disordered.In this paper,considering function's logic completion process and interface together,a test case generation method based on data flow graph for interactive software function testing is proposed.This method describes transaction and generates test cases with data flows.This method could generate effective test cases,test interactive software function more comprehensively,and locate faults conveniently.
关 键 词:软件测试 功能测试 数据流图 测试路径 测试用例
分 类 号:TP311[自动化与计算机技术—计算机软件与理论]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.15